
Mpezeni Welcomes Sanitation and Clean Water Initiatives for Ncwala Ceremony
By Chansa Mayani
Paramount Chief Mpezeni of the Ngoni people of Eastern Province is happy that the government has moved in to ensure that there is proper sanitation and clean water for the multitudes of people attending this year’s Ncwala ceremony in Chipata.
The Paramount Chief says he is confident that the health measures put in place will ensure the safety of everybody attending the ceremony.
He was speaking when a team of medical personnel from the Zambia Flying Doctors Service paid a courtesy call on him at his Ephendukeni Palace.
And Zambia Flying Doctors Service Director Medical Services Chisanga Puta said her team is ready for any emergency that may occur during the ceremony.
Dr. Puta said an aircraft will be on standby at Chipata Airport for any emergency evacuation.
The team of medical personnel will be camped at the Mutenguleni main arena to offer dental, eye, and general screening while an orthopedic surgeon will be stationed at Chipata Level One Hospital.
